Württemberg, Kingdom. A Wilhelm Cross With Swords Newly Listed Lower crossguard is numbered 146730(Wilhelmskreuz). Instituted on 13 September 1915. A bronze Rupert cross paty, the obverse centre bears the cipher of King WIlhelm II within an oak leaf wreath, the 12 oclock arm bears the imperial crown, the 6 oclock arm bears the date 1915, the reverse centre presents the inscription KRIEGSVERDIENST within a circular oak wreath border, two upwards facing crossed swords lay between the arms, measuring 44. 49 mm (w) x 48. 75 mm (h), with suspension
